Ready to push the limits of what’s technically possible? Together, we enter a new era of intelligent machines, with you as a driving force:
-
Localization: Choose tune, integrated, and adapt robust localization and SLAM pipelines using multi-sensor fusion (LiDAR, cameras, IMU, wheel odometry) within the ROS2 framework
-
Path planning: Chose, tune, integrate and adapt path planning and obstacle avoidance algorithms for safe navigation around people and obstacles
-
Autononmy: Develop behavior- and decision logic that enables the robot reacting to the various challenges of navigation in complex and dynamic environments
-
Full-body-motion: Integrate navigation with manipulation workflows for coordinated mobile manipulation tasks
-
Testing and validation: Test and validate the navigation and localization in Isaac Sim
-
Teamplayer: Work in a multi-disciplinary and agileteam and actively contribute to the roadmap and future of intelligent robotic systems
-
An excellent Master’s or PhD in Robotics, Computer Science, Software Engineering, or equivalent
-
5+ years of professional experience in mobile robot navigation, localization, or autonomous systems
-
A proven track record: Your projects show measurable impact.
-
The desire to go beyond the state of the art. You don’t just want to improve, you want to create something new.
-
Strong proficiency in Python and C++
-
Solid understanding of SLAM algorithms, state estimation, sensor fusion techniques and path planning
-
Experience with extending and customizing the Nav2 stack to meet the specific requirements of mobile manipulation (custom recovery behaviors, custom costmap layers integrating with perception...)
-
Experience with LiDAR, depth cameras, IMUs, and odometry integration
-
Familiarity with behavior trees and robot state machines
-
Experience writing tests for robotics systems and working with CI/CD pipelines and Git
-
Excellent communication skills in English, German is optional but welcome.
